位置:含义网 > 资讯中心 > 行业知识 > 文章详情

tsp名称是什么意思

作者:含义网
|
54人看过
发布时间:2026-02-10 23:13:46
tsp名称是什么意思TSP 是“旅行商问题”的缩写,是运筹学与计算机科学中的经典问题之一。TSP 是一个组合优化问题,其核心在于寻找一条经过所有城市一次且仅一次的路径,使得总距离最小。这个问题虽然看起来简单,但实际上在实际应用
tsp名称是什么意思
tsp名称是什么意思
TSP 是“旅行商问题”的缩写,是运筹学与计算机科学中的经典问题之一。TSP 是一个组合优化问题,其核心在于寻找一条经过所有城市一次且仅一次的路径,使得总距离最小。这个问题虽然看起来简单,但实际上在实际应用中非常复杂,尤其在大规模数据下,计算难度呈指数级增长。
TSP 的起源可以追溯到20世纪50年代,当时它被提出并用于物流、交通规划、网络设计等多个领域。随着计算机科学的发展,TSP 成为了研究组合优化问题的典型代表,也是人工智能和算法设计中的重要课题之一。
在TSP问题中,每个城市都可以被访问一次,而路径的总距离是所有城市之间距离的总和。TSP 的目标是找到一条路径,使得总距离最小。虽然这个问题看似简单,但其解法在计算上非常复杂,尤其是当城市数量较多时,计算时间会变得极其巨大。
TSP 问题在数学上是一个NP难问题,这意味着它的解法无法在多项式时间内完成。因此,许多研究者和工程师都致力于寻找近似解法,即能够在合理时间内找到接近最优解的路径。
在现代计算机科学中,TSP 问题不仅被用于理论研究,还被广泛应用于实际问题的求解中。例如,在物流行业中,TSP 问题可以用来优化配送路线,使得配送员能够在最短的时间内完成所有送货任务。在城市规划中,TSP 问题可以用来优化公共交通路线,减少通勤时间,提高出行效率。
TSP 问题的研究不仅推动了算法设计的发展,也促进了计算机科学、运筹学和人工智能等多个学科的交叉融合。随着计算能力的不断提升,TSP 问题的求解方法也在不断改进,从传统的动态规划方法到现代的启发式算法,再到机器学习和深度学习技术,TSP 问题的求解方式也在不断演变。
在实际应用中,TSP 问题的求解往往需要结合具体问题的特性进行调整。例如,有些问题可能要求路径必须经过某些特定的城市,或者路径的某些部分需要满足特定的条件。这些限制条件会增加TSP问题的复杂性,同时也为算法设计提供了更多的挑战。
TSP 问题的研究不仅在学术界具有重要意义,也在工业界有着广泛的应用。随着大数据和人工智能技术的发展,TSP 问题的求解方式也在不断进步。现代算法不仅能够解决大规模的TSP问题,还能够提供更优的解法,从而为实际问题的求解提供更有效的支持。
TSP 问题的研究和应用,不仅推动了计算机科学的发展,也促进了运筹学和优化理论的进步。TSP 问题的解决方法和研究成果,已经成为现代科技发展的重要组成部分。无论是理论研究,还是实际应用,TSP 问题都展现出了其重要的价值和意义。
在TSP问题的研究中,科学家们不断探索新的算法和方法,以应对日益增长的计算复杂性。随着计算机硬件的不断进步和算法设计的不断创新,TSP 问题的求解能力也在不断提升。无论是传统的动态规划方法,还是现代的启发式算法,甚至是机器学习和深度学习技术,都在不断推动TSP问题的求解方式向前发展。
TSP 问题的研究和应用,不仅在学术界具有重要意义,也在工业界有着广泛的应用。随着大数据和人工智能技术的发展,TSP 问题的求解方式也在不断进步。现代算法不仅能够解决大规模的TSP问题,还能够提供更优的解法,从而为实际问题的求解提供更有效的支持。
TSP 问题的研究和应用,不仅推动了计算机科学的发展,也促进了运筹学和优化理论的进步。TSP 问题的解决方法和研究成果,已经成为现代科技发展的重要组成部分。无论是理论研究,还是实际应用,TSP 问题都展现出了其重要的价值和意义。